According to your scsilist, the Ultrium name is Tape0 so for the tape 
you would use  'Archive Device = Tape0'.
For the changer you need to install the HP  windows driver for you 
changer.  It will then appear as Changer0, and you would use
'Changer Device = Changer0'.

>     Hi all,
>
>     In my Bacula Server I have this list of devices given by bacula's
>     "device list"
>
>
>     Device                                                    Type    
>     Physical     Name
>     ======                                               ====    
>     ========     ====
>     HL-DT-ST DVD+-RW GSA-H21L     CDRom    0:0:0:0      CdRom0
>     HP      Ultrium 1-SCSI  P53W                 Tape     4:0:5:0     
>     Tape0
>     HP      1x8 autoloader  1.50                   Changer  4:0:5:1
>     DY5402J FCM024K         1.0            CDRom    5:0:0:0
>
>     Press any key to continue
>
>     I need to specify my "Archive Device = " and my "Changer Device ="
>     in the bacula's configuration file  bacula-sd .conf   !!
>     The problem is : under windows I have no idea about how the system
>     names the HP Ultrium nor the HP autoloader.
>
>     is there any one who tried the experience under windows and can
>     help me ??
